1972 Chevrolet Cheyenne Pickup C10
This is the truck you have been looking for. Does not need a thing. Get in the truck and go have some fun. This truck has been professionally restored. The paint is outstanding and is a very strong runner. Very Fun Truck. No Expense has been spared.
Engine Features:
-396 Small Block Stroker Engine
-Hooker longtube headers
-Dart Heads
-500hp
-Edelbrock Carburator
-High Rise Intake Manifold
-March Serpentine Pulley System
-Aluminum gas tank
-Chrome Dress Up kit
-Optima Battery
-Flowmaster Exhaust
Transmission/Driveline
-700-r4 transmission
-12 Bolt Rear end
-Moser Axles
-Posi
Suspension
-4 link rear suspension
-panhard bar
-Air Ride Technologies Suspension
-Front Tubular Control Arms
-Ride Pro Air Ride controller
-Chassis completely striped and repainted
-four wheel disc brakes
-Dual tank setup
-17" American Racing wheels
Body
-Originally from Texas
-Straight body panels
-Outstanding paint
-Trim Replaced
-Harwood cowl hood
-Every nut and bolt replaced
-Short Bed
Other Features
-Cup holder kit
-Vent window delete
-CD player with upgraded speakers
-Lokar shifter
-Auto meter Carbon fiber series Gauges (yes they work)
-Billet Dash trim
-Ron Francis Wiring kit
-Electric Fans

GM patent reveals new two-stage turbocharger
Fri, Jun 24 2016Modern turbochargers may be some of the best ever made, but performance is something that engineers are always trying to improve. According to GM Inside News, General Motors (GM) is hoping to alleviate some of the negative aspects of a two-stage turbocharger setup with a newly-patented design. The patent, that was filed on May 19, 2016, reveals a clever bypass system that allows the engine, a four-cylinder unit, to optimize both the low-pressure and high-pressure inlets for its respective functions. According to the filing, a conventional two-stage turbocharger setup is engineered to allow both turbines to operate simultaneously at low and mid engine speeds. At high engine speeds, only the low-pressure turbine works. The setup can't isolate either the low or high pressure side, which can impair low-end performance. GM's new two-stage turbocharger setup looks to eliminate this by linking the high-pressure turbo to the exhaust manifold through the high-pressure inlet duct. The low-pressure turbo is attached to the high-pressure turbo by a low-pressure inlet duct, which is linked to a connecting channel. A single actuator that is housed in the exhaust manifold creates a bypass that can opens the high-pressure inlet or close the connecting channel. Depending on what the engine load and speed is, the ECU guides the actuator—a single rotating spindle with discs corresponding to flanges on the high and low pressure sides—to isolate one of the two turbos. Isolating the turbos allow the respective inlets to be engineered for the best possible fluid dynamic performance. The setup should increase performance and decrease lag. There's no word on what car this setup will make an appearance on, but it will most likely be used in premium vehicles before trickling down to the rest of GM's vehicles. One of the world's largest muscle car museums is auctioning off its cars
Mon, Jan 11 2021Rick Treworgy's Muscle Car City is one of the biggest collections of high-performance American cars in the world. With over 200 cars of mostly GM makes, it's a mecca for fans of the golden age of Detroit iron. Unfortunately, the museum will be shutting its doors for good on Jan. 17 and auctioning off most of its assets with no reserve. The collection is, to put it bluntly, astounding. Advertised as a combined 65,000-plus horsepower, it occupies a 60,000-square-foot retail space in Punta Gorda, Fla., in a former Walmart store. It make sense when you learn that founder Rick Treworgy made his fortune in the commercial real estate business. As a hobby, he began to amass a truly jaw-dropping collection of muscle cars, filling out a collection that often has every year of a particular model represented, or a grouping of the rarest and highest-performance option packages of that year or model. Often, Treworgy bought placeholders while scouring the country for even rarer versions. It helps that Muscle Car City also houses a showroom where unwanted cars are sold, as well as its own speed shop that stocks plenty of parts. There's even a '50s-style diner called Stingray's Bar and Grill. According to a 2014 episode of Car Crazy, Treworgy has 80 Corvettes alone, more than the actual Corvette Museum. Among them are 20 models from 1967, one of Treworgy's favorites. The rest span the decades from 1954 (he once had a '53 but sold it) to a recently acquired 2020 C8, which, according to The Drive, has only 300 miles on the odometer. You like Impalas? There are models of every year from 1958 to 1969. El Caminos? He's got 'em from 1964 to 1972. Novas? Every year from 1963 to 1970 is represented. Most are the more desirable examples of each breed, with four-speed transmissions, the biggest blocks, and unicorn option packages like a factory 1965 Z16 SS396 Chevelle, one of 200 that were ordered off-menu at Chevy dealerships. And don't even get us started on the Camaros, which include not one, but two COPO 1969s. Treworgy even owns the only known surviving example of a 1936 Chevrolet Phaeton, of which only seven were built. On top of it all, many of these cars are concours quality and have won awards at prestigious car shows. While it's sad to see a collection like this broken up, Treworgy told The Drive that he'd been planning to retire next year anyway. However, the COVID-19 pandemic sped up those plans, greatly reducing the number of visitors to his museum.
Next Chevy Volt will be 2016 model and ride on new chassis
Fri, Mar 7 2014What do we know about the 2016 Chevy Volt? Well, for now, all we can do is try to put the puzzle together without the box. Thankfully, a new batch of pieces has arrived from a new report in Edmunds, which says that the 2016 model year will introduce the second generation of a car that hasn't been dramatically updated since it went on sale in 2010. The new Volt is getting an "evolutionary styling change" and will ride on a new front-drive platform that has been developed by General Motors. GM's Kevin Kelly told AutoblogGreen that he has "no comment on future products," but he did acknowledge that Chevrolet is working on a second-generation Volt, "but I can't say anything about timing." Everybody already knew that a next-gen Volt is coming, so that's not a surprise. What we don't know is any real concrete information on the car itself. The few tidbits of information we do have help define the outlines of the next version of Chevy's halo car, but they're not confirmed yet. For the record, they range from the eye-raising (a $10,000 price drop) to the logical (20 percent more electric range). We can't see the whole picture yet, but the pieces do point to the 2016 Volt, which would be released next year sometime, being a much bigger deal than the last update, when the Volt's range was increased by three electric miles thanks to a battery capacity increase of 16 kWh to 16.5.
